Black Hawk style CQC Holsters and they're ability to weather hits

This is a bit of a public "poll".

I'd recently picked up a SERPA holster for my sidearm to try out instead of my usual method of shoving it in a mag pouch. I have long gangly arms, and the only palce I could find open on my belt or rig that I could easily draw from was on my chest. After 4-5 games like this I took a BB directly to the release button, which seems to have blown apart the mechanism that actually holds the pistol in place. Admittedly, it was a repro, as I wanted to see if I even liked the style before I went balls deep buying a brand name one.

My questions for those of you who use these holsters, especially mounted to your chest:

1) Are these kind of hits that common, or was it just shit luck that I got hit in the exact wrong spot/ do hits there usually cause this kind of damage?

2) Would a non-china re-brand hold up any better? Or is it too small a piece to take that kind of impact no matter what?

3) Assuming that this would be a common problem to happen, is there anything that works well as an ablative guard on the button to reduce impact force?
